Output 8912d0095acf77d3f23b7140207aec86ddd487671973133bd29667560c6ce3a9:138

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8c3cd25dd216e8ecd7ca5a649c83d0002718c2b0a3cd9ebcdeee4795f77c0d6
address
bc1perpu6fway9hgantu5knynjpaqqp8rrptpg7dn67damj8jhmhcrtq6d2syc
transaction
8912d0095acf77d3f23b7140207aec86ddd487671973133bd29667560c6ce3a9
spent
true